The decision about where to position a ceiling fan matters just as much as the fan itself, and this is where numerous Sydney house owners ignore the preparation required before ceiling fan installation starts. Centring the fan within the room is the basic approach, but it is not constantly the most efficient one. In open-plan areas where the cooking area, dining, and living locations combine into one big footprint, a single centrally positioned fan rarely delivers appropriate air flow to every corner. Numerous smaller sized fans placed attentively across the space will exceed one extra-large fan each time. Spaces with raked or risen ceilings provide their own challenge, needing angled canopy adaptors throughout ceiling fan installation to guarantee the motor housing sits level and the blades move air straight downward rather than at an inefficient diagonal.

Colour, finish, and blade material are choices that property owners frequently treat as simply aesthetic throughout the ceiling fan installation process, but they carry useful repercussions as well. Timber blades add warmth and character to a space but can warp in environments with high humidity or significant temperature level swings, which is an authentic factor to consider for Sydney homes close to the water or with bad roof insulation. Moulded composite blades resist warping and are much easier to wipe down, making them a more long lasting long-term option for most households. The fan's motor housing finish should also be thought about in relation to Ceiling Fan Installation the environment-- brushed nickel and matte black are both popular in contemporary Sydney interiors, however certain coverings hold up much better than others in homes exposed to seaside conditions. These details deserve raising with the supplier before devoting to a ceiling fan installation instead of finding them as problems later on.

Resale value is a dimension of ceiling fan installation that does not receive nearly enough attention. Sydney's property market is competitive, and purchasers inspecting homes discover the quality and condition of components throughout. A ceiling fan installation that has actually been executed cleanly, with the ideal fan for the room, properly concealed wiring, and a finish that complements the interior, signals to a prospective purchaser that the residential or commercial property has actually been preserved with care. In Australia, where warm weather is a near-constant truth throughout much of the year, functional and attractive ceiling fans are viewed as a genuine asset instead of an afterthought, including viewed value that surpasses the modest expense of the installation itself.
